Kinds Of Recliner Sofa Chairs
There are a number of types of recliner sofa chairs to consider, each catering to different tastes and needs. Here is a breakdown:
|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Requirement Recliners | Fundamental models that feature a lever or button to engage the reclining system. |
| Power Recliners | Electric recliners with adjustable reclining angles, controlled via a remote. |
| Wall-Hugger Recliners | Created to optimize space, these chairs require minimal range from the wall. |
| Reclining Loveseats | Two-seat options that recline, excellent for couples needing convenience side by side. |
| Rocking Recliners | Combines the gentle motion of rocking with reclining abilities, suitable for relaxation. |
| Massage Recliners | Feature built-in massage choices for an enhanced relaxation experience. |
Functions of Recliner Sofa Chairs
When acquiring a recliner sofa chair, it's crucial to evaluate the features that best satisfy your comfort and relaxation needs. Here are key features to think about:
- Reclining Mechanism: Manual or power recline choices enable tailored seating positions.
- Product: Options include leather, fabric, and microfiber, each with its advantages in style and convenience.
- Adjustability: Some models offer adjustable headrests, back assistance, and armrests.
- Space Requirements: Wall-hugging styles are ideal for smaller rooms, decreasing required space for reclining.
- Additionals: Built-in heating, massage functions, cup holders, and USB charging ports boost the user experience.
How to Choose the Right Recliner Sofa Chair
Selecting the right recliner includes careful factor to consider of several aspects. Here are some steps you can require to ensure you select the best chair for your lifestyle:
1. Examine Your Space
- Procedure the area where you will put the recliner to ensure it fits easily.
- Consider the wall space needed if the chair will recline backwards.
2. Define Your Needs
- Determine the primary usage (e.g., seeing television, reading, taking a snooze, etc).
- If you're seeking health advantages (like improved circulation), try to find features like power recline.
3. Test Before You Buy
- Attempt various designs in store to assess convenience, height, and ease of reclining.
- Look for product feel and whether it grips you properly.
4. Consider Style
- Think about how a recliner will fit into your existing design. Select colors and textures that complement your room.
- Explore options that match your visual choices.
5. Set a Budget
- Recliner rates can vary substantially. Set a budget before shopping to limit your choices.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Can recliner chairs suit small spaces?
A1: Yes, wall-hugger recliners are specifically developed for small spaces as they need less distance from the wall to totally recline.
Q2: Are power recliners better than manual recliners?
A2: It depends upon personal preference. Power recliners use smoother adjustments and more versatility in reclining positions, while manual recliners are usually more budget-friendly and do not need electrical energy.
Q3: How do I clean up a fabric recliner?
A3: Vacuum regularly to remove dust and particles. For stains, use a fabric cleaner particularly created for upholstery, following the producer's guidelines.
Q4: What is the very best material for a recliner chair?
A4: It depends upon the intended use. Leather is durable and easy to clean, while fabric uses a softer, more comfortable feel. Microfiber is a popular option for its stain resistance and aesthetic appeal.
